The Building Blocks: DeFi and Real World Assets

Decentralized Finance (DeFi) has been a revolutionary force since its inception, offering a suite of financial services without the need for intermediaries like banks. Through smart contracts on blockchain platforms, DeFi provides lending, borrowing, trading, and earning opportunities. DeFi’s most distinctive feature is its transparency and accessibility, allowing anyone with an internet connection to participate.

Real World Assets (RWA), on the other hand, are tangible or intangible assets that exist outside the digital realm, such as real estate, commodities, and even art. The concept of tokenizing these assets, converting them into digital form via blockchain technology, has opened new avenues for investment and liquidity.

Credit Yield: The Core Concept

Credit yield refers to the return on an investment in a debt security. In traditional finance, it’s a measure of the income generated relative to the amount invested. In the DeFi landscape, credit yield takes on a new dimension, especially when applied to DeFi RWA.

Imagine a scenario where real estate properties, commodities, or even business loans are tokenized and made available on a DeFi platform. Tokenized assets can be pooled to generate yield, which can then be distributed to participants in the form of interest or dividends. This is where Credit Yield DeFi RWA becomes particularly compelling. It merges the stability and tangible nature of RWA with the dynamic and decentralized nature of DeFi.

Yield Farming: A New Paradigm

At the heart of Credit Yield DeFi RWA lies the concept of yield farming. Yield farming in DeFi involves providing liquidity to decentralized exchanges or liquidity pools to earn rewards in the form of cryptocurrency. In the context of Credit Yield DeFi RWA, this means providing liquidity to platforms that offer tokenized RWA, thereby generating a continuous stream of yield.

Yield farming is not just a method of earning passive income but also a way to democratize access to traditional credit markets. By tokenizing real world assets, DeFi platforms can offer these assets to a global audience, enabling small investors to participate in the credit market traditionally dominated by institutional players.

Smart Contracts: The Backbone of Trust

Smart contracts are self-executing contracts with the terms of the agreement directly written into code. In the realm of Credit Yield DeFi RWA, smart contracts play a pivotal role in automating the lending, borrowing, and yield generation processes. They ensure that all transactions are transparent, secure, and tamper-proof, thereby reducing the need for intermediaries and the associated costs.

For instance, when a tokenized real estate property is leased out through a DeFi platform, a smart contract can automatically manage the rental payments, distribute the yield to stakeholders, and handle any disputes or default scenarios. This level of automation and transparency is a significant leap forward in financial technology.
